苹果电脑做软件开发

苹果电脑做软件开发原标题:苹果电脑做软件开发

导读:

苹果电脑,凭借其独特的设计、出色的性能和稳定的系统,一直是软件开发者们的首选工具,如果你也想加入这个队伍,用苹果电脑进行软件开发,那么今天这篇详细介绍,绝对能帮助你快速上手,下...

苹果电脑,凭借其独特的设计、出色的性能和稳定的系统,一直是软件开发者们的首选工具,如果你也想加入这个队伍,用苹果电脑进行软件开发,那么今天这篇详细介绍,绝对能帮助你快速上手,下面,就让我们一起来看看,如何用苹果电脑打造一个舒适的软件开发环境吧!

选购合适的苹果电脑

苹果电脑做软件开发

你需要选购一台适合自己的苹果电脑,苹果电脑主要分为MacBook Air、MacBook Pro和iMac三个系列,对于软件开发来说,更推荐性能强劲的MacBook Pro或iMac,如果你的预算有限,MacBook Air也能满足基本需求。

在选择具体型号时,要关注以下几点:

  1. 处理器:尽量选择性能更强的处理器,如M1芯片或Intel Core i5/i7等。
  2. 内存:软件开发过程中,需要运行多个程序和工具,建议选择16GB或更高内存的电脑。
  3. 存储:固态硬盘(SSD)的读写速度远高于传统机械硬盘,能显著提高开发效率,建议选择512GB或更高容量的SSD。

搭建开发环境

选购完苹果电脑后,接下来就是搭建开发环境了,以下是一些建议:

  1. 操作系统:确保你的苹果电脑安装了最新版本的macOS操作系统,以获得最佳性能和兼容性。

  2. 开发工具:根据你要开发的软件类型,选择合适的开发工具,以下是一些常见开发工具:

  • Web开发:Sublime Text、Visual Studio Code、WebStorm等;
  • iOS开发:Xcode;
  • Android开发:Android Studio;
  • 后端开发:IntelliJ IDEA、Eclipse等。

编程语言:掌握一门或多门编程语言是软件开发的基础,以下是一些常见的编程语言:

  • Swift:苹果官方推荐的iOS开发语言;
  • Objective-C:另一种iOS开发语言,逐渐被Swift取代;
  • Java:Android开发的主要语言;
  • Python、JavaScript、PHP等:适用于Web开发和其他领域。

版本控制:学会使用版本控制工具,如Git,可以帮助你更好地管理代码和协作开发。

学习资源与实战项目

有了开发工具和编程语言基础,接下来就是不断学习和实践了,以下是一些建议:

学习资源:以下是一些优质的学习资源:

  • 在线教程:如菜鸟教程、慕课网等;
  • 视频课程:如极客时间、B站等;
  • 书籍:如《Swift编程》、《Effective Java》等。

实战项目:通过实际操作项目,可以让你更快地掌握开发技能,以下是一些建议:

  • 参与开源项目:如GitHub上的开源项目,可以让你了解实际开发流程;
  • 自己动手:尝试独立完成一个小项目,如制作一个简单的博客系统、iOS应用等。

提高开发效率

在使用苹果电脑进行软件开发的过程中,以下技巧可以帮助你提高开发效率:

  1. 善用快捷键:掌握常用的快捷键,可以让你在开发过程中事半功倍;
  2. 利用插件:安装一些实用的插件,如代码提示、自动格式化等,可以让你更专注于编写代码;
  3. 学会调试:掌握调试技巧,如断点调试、性能分析等,有助于快速定位和解决问题。

用苹果电脑进行软件开发,不仅能让你享受到优雅的设计和流畅的操作体验,还能助你成为更高效的开发者,从选购电脑、搭建开发环境,到学习资源、提高效率,希望以上内容能为你提供帮助,就放手去实践吧,相信你会收获满满!

返回列表
上一篇:
下一篇: